Bladder Paraganglioma
Known as:
Paraganglioma of Bladder
, Paraganglioma of the Bladder
, Urinary Bladder Paraganglioma
Expand
A benign or malignant extra-adrenal sympathetic paraganglioma arising from the urinary bladder. Clinical signs include hypertension and hematuria.
